Night shift: evacuation-chair store on Stairwell C, Level 3, was restocked today. Two Havermont chairs serviced, one sent to Drayle Safety for repair. Check the seal on the store door at 02:00 rounds. If the seal is broken, log it and re-secure. Door access for the store uses the pass below.

staff pass of fajop-kajop = bdg-H-83

Account Recovery — ProfileStore Sharding (Larkspur Systems)

If a user's recovery request stalls, first confirm which shard holds their profile. ProfileStore splits accounts across twelve shards keyed by account UUID prefix. Contractors should never rebalance shards manually; use the drain tool instead. Once you've confirmed the shard is healthy, unlock the recovery console with the passphrase below.

unlock words, bahop-fawef: novmir-druwyn-soriel-rusdor-kasion

Subject: Handover — validator plugin stuff

Hey Priya,

Passing you the baton on Checkwright, our plugin system for data validators. The new schema-drift plugin shipped Tuesday and mostly behaves, but it occasionally flags empty CSV uploads as "malformed" — harmless, just noisy. I've muted the alert until Friday. If support escalates anything about plugin load failures, the fix is usually bumping the registry cache. Questions after I'm off? Reach the Checkwright maintainers at the address below.

billing contact of hawip-kahif = zorwyn@tolvaqlabs.corp

# Break-Glass: Catalog Cache Invalidation

Scope: the Pinrow product catalog at Veldstone Retail. If stale prices persist after a purge and the Hollowmere invalidation queue is wedged, use break-glass to flush the edge tier directly. Contractors: get verbal sign-off from the catalog lead first. Steps: open the Hollowmere admin shell, select emergency-flush, confirm the tenant, and run it once — repeated flushes thrash the origin. Access is logged and expires after 20 minutes. Unseal the admin shell with the passphrase below.

recovery phrase for kahop-tajog: istix-casvan